Bunyaruguru United FC Secures Promotion to FUFA Big League with Penalty Shootout Victory

In an exhilarating contest, Bunyaruguru United Football Club from Rubirizi district has qualified for the second tier division of Ugandan football, the FUFA Big League. This triumph came after a nail-biting 4-1 victory in a post-match penalty shootout over Rwenzori Lions.

The return leg of the promotional playoff ended in a 1-0 win for Bunyaruguru United, equalizing the aggregate scores at 1-1, setting the stage for an intense penalty shootout. Muhammad Kasule was the scorer of Bunyaruguru United's solitary goal in the second half.

During the shootout, captain Hassan Sanya, Mark Ssali, Muhammad Kasule, and Vincent Kibuuka successfully converted their attempts. Goalkeeper Nazir Kibule Obbo impressively saved two of Rwenzori Lion's kicks.

"I am thrilled about this achievement. I express my gratitude to the team management, players, coaches, supporters, and the media," head coach Jajja Noah Mugerwa commented. Jajja Mugerwa credited their success to the disciplined, hardworking, and committed players, which he attributed to the consistent financial support from the club chairman, Hon. David Katureebe Tugume, who is also an aspiring member of parliament for Rubirizi district.

With this victory, Bunyaruguru United joins Kampala's CATDA and Eastern region's Iganga United, who have already secured their places in the second division. The fourth slot will be filled by either Nebbi Central (West Nile) or Young Elephants (Northern region). The second leg between Nebbi Central and Young Elephants will take place on 29th June 2025, with Nebbi Central currently holding a slim 1-0 advantage from the first leg.

Four clubs were relegated from the 2024-2025 FUFA Big League; Booma, MYDA, Busoga United, and Arua Hill.
